    Compressed hydrogen is a storage form whereby hydrogen gas is kept under pressures to increase the storage density. Compressed hydrogen in hydrogen tanks at 350 bar (5,000 psi) and 700 bar (10,000 psi) are used for hydrogen tank systems in vehicles, based on type IV carbon-composite technology.

    The United States Space Force (USSF) is the space force branch of the United States Armed Forces and one of the eight uniformed services of the United States. [7] The United States Space Force traces its origins to the Air Force, Army, and Navy's military space programs created during the beginning of the Cold War.

    The Cheyenne Mountain Complex is a United States Space Force installation and defensive bunker located in unincorporated El Paso County, Colorado, next to the city of Colorado Springs, [2] at the Cheyenne Mountain Space Force Station, [a] which hosts the activities of several tenant units.
